Output 8593e1621d07a833c404bb1b6e07ce6306b45e96b696d8ef3610503c2406783e:1

value
575090
script pubkey
OP_0 OP_PUSHBYTES_20 bc19c1cc619290741e8bcb1887a54fde3366f74c
address
bc1qhsvurnrpj2g8g85tevvg0f20mcekda6vp0ka43
transaction
8593e1621d07a833c404bb1b6e07ce6306b45e96b696d8ef3610503c2406783e
spent
true